
As a game between the Pittsburgh Steelers and Detroit Lions continued into the second half, receiver DK Metcalf remained on the field. That despite him throwing a punch at a fan in the stands midway through the second quarter.
According to reporting from the Detroit Free Press, the NFL was not able to intervene with an ejection. The outlet reported the following:
โThe NFL said in a statement it cannot intervene for an ejection of Metcalf.โ No further detail was provided.
Rules expert Gene Steratore also provided some clarification on why DK Metcalf was not ejected despite throwing a punch at a fan. He weighed in on the gameโs broadcast on CBS.
โOn this situation because the officials did not see this and you wouldnโt expect them to where DK Metcalf was, itโs not something they can weigh in on from an officiating standpoint,โ Steratore said. โI have been notified, though, that that will be delivered to compliance with the NFL and theyโll address it at that point.โ
The sequence in question with DK Metcalf occurred during the second quarter. Cameras were on him when he made the swing.
